Sir, i just want to know that how to write the over all sum <= 1-beta in the constraints?
e.g. if value of beta =0.4,
and i have 6 phi values to optimize, i have to optimize its value but the sum of all these 6 phi values not exceed 1-beta (i.e 0.6).

Are you sure you only have 6 unknowns? In your earlier post, you had more.
If you truly only have 6 unknowns, use the A,b inputs in
x = fmincon(fun,x0,A,b,______)
with
A=ones(1,6);
b=1-beta;

A constraint is nonlinear if it is not linear. A linear constraint is one that can be expressed with matrix-vector multiplication,
A*x<=b
Aeq*x=beq
